The interview process had one group session with 20 people in Spanish and English. Then there were two rounds with managers, one technical and one non-technical. The last round was with a partner, and I was already accepted by then.

Confirmed questions1 question
  • What is the correlation coefficient?

The interview was a one-on-one, starting with a phone call, then a video call. The partner was really nice and willing to help, even though they were late and apologized for it. I liked how the interview went. We started with personal topics, then professional ones, and finally some classic questions like 'why did you choose X?'

Had a Skype interview that was about 30 minutes long. The interviewer was Spanish and was polite. He was very young. At the beginning, he asked me how many languages I knew, and when I said Spanish, we switched to speaking it. He was really interested in the details of how long it took me to finish my undergraduate studies, but he wasn't very interested in my postgraduate experience.
